Look and Feel
- Rugged construction with a rubber casing to help grip.
- Large, full-color display makes it easy to see everything.
- Navigation buttons help you quickly access functions and features.
Connectivity
- Easily connects and works with most 1996 or later vehicles
- Works on most 2000 or later EU-based vehicles
- Connects to local Wifi for software upgrades (free for one year)
Functionality
- The Launch CRP429 is a full-systems scan and diagnostic tool.
- Reads and clears all OBDII codes, including oil light reset, EPB (Electronic Parking Brake), ABS, SAS (Steering Angle)m BMS (Battery Maintenance System) Injector Coding and others.
- Delivers live data on multiple systems, including ABS, Engine, Transmission, Emission System, SRS, Fuel, Lights, .Wipers and SRS).
- Connects to Wifi or free updates
- Contains a superfast A5 quad-core processor which loads and scans quickly
- Comes with an easy to see touchscreen interface
